The Fox Run Stainless Steel Rolling Pin features a hefty 3.99-pound stainless steel body with smooth nylon ball bearings for effortless rolling. Its nonporous, freeze-friendly surface prevents dough from sticking and cross-contamination, making it a durable, hygienic, and stylish essential for any serious baker.

My wife loves to bake thin crust pizza, pies, etc, even though she has significant osteoarthritis and severe pain in her hands. We tested about 50+ rolling pins, from granite, to silicone, to wood, and this rolling pin is the easiest for her to use (especially cold). What I like about it is the length and the slimmer width. Most rolling pins are 1.5" or more in diameter, and this one is thin, lightweight and easy to maneuver. Without question, the malleable features are a huge plus. Her hands are medium-sized, mine are large, and this rolling pin is perfect for both of us. Love this rolling pin for everything. It's very helpful for puff pastry because it is light weight and I can roll it out without over pushing down on the layers. Also works perfectly for heavier pastry like a pie crust. It really shines though when I make pot stickers, perogies where you need a very thin dough and want the edges thinner than the middle. Very happy with this rolling pin. Washes up great and easy to store.
